Output 58127607f417982d7eb7004386263e3bfae6acf4487e5d0d2a1ee9401b05b4b6:0

value
525483797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a51ab41ce33b55a5f607aff8dd8ab55c9420eb3a OP_EQUAL
address
MNx9iUhswsMYFaDhNK6qAfjeJPicrQ4GWS
transaction
58127607f417982d7eb7004386263e3bfae6acf4487e5d0d2a1ee9401b05b4b6
spent
true